AC Problem, Please help

Hello Everyone.

Charged my ac today and got some cool air for about half an hour then the system stoped sending cool air, pressures are correct and it seems that the ac compressor does not kick in. checked all fuses and nothing is burned. No curent gets to AC clutch.
